fully implemented support for B_DOCUMENT_WINDOW_LOOK windows (resize tab overlapping top_view's area). Added support for live moving and resizing the layers shown, resizing is done by dragging from the lower right corner of a layer or winborder. Fixed a bug with for B_FULL_UPDATE_ON_RESIZE flag. More testing remains to be done because there seems to be a problem with clipping under certain circumstances, but I'm nearly finished. :-)
